I'm right in the middle of doing this............

I'll post results for my engine when I'm done. (centrifugal first)


What I'm doing is locking out the advance mechanism, then figuring out the max advance (without ping) at various rpm's (WOT). Then I'll try to match it with the springs (minus 2 degrees as a safety buffer).

Then I want to see what the max advance is at various rpm's and manifold vacuum and see if I can get a vacuum can to match that.......
